Wenzhou recently initiated extensive campaigns, encouraging citizens to plant, cherish, protect, and advocate for greenery in celebration of the 46th National Tree Planting Day.

In recent years, Wenzhou has excelled in scientific afforestation and enhancing forest quality. Last year, the growth rate in the total output value of the city's forestry industry ranked first in Zhejiang province.

Last year, Wenzhou ranked first in the province in terms of national afforestation rate, covering 22,700 mu (1,513 hectares). The city's enhanced the quality of 514,900 mu of forest. Additionally, it completed nearly 30,000 mu of camellia planting and low-yield forest transformation and saw a record-breaking 683,500 participants in national tree planting activities.

In addition, Wenzhou prioritized forest protection, building 75.33 kilometers of emergency forest fire roads and recording zero major forest fires or casualties. The pine wilt disease prevention and control task achieved a three-year milestone, reducing affected areas and dead trees by 787,000 mu and 1.03 million trees, respectively, the most in the province.

Moreover, in exploring the utilization of forestry resources, Wenzhou donated 26,826 metric tons of carbon sinks, also the most in the province.
